ARRI Skypanels Setup
This guide explains how to configure ARRI Skypanels for control from the Disguise platform using Mode 24. The setup applies to Skypanel 30C, 60C, 120C, and 360C.
1. Selecting the Correct Skypanel Mode
Section titled “1. Selecting the Correct Skypanel Mode”To control any Skypanel model from Disguise
Section titled “To control any Skypanel model from Disguise”-
Set the fixture to Mode 24 – LE CCT & RGBW (8-bit). This mode provides full RGBW control.
-
Ensure Art-Net is enabled so the panel can receive DMX data from Disguise.
Mode 24 Channel Map (8-bit)
Section titled “Mode 24 Channel Map (8-bit)”Mode 24: LE CCT & RGBW, 8 bit resolution per function
Section titled “Mode 24: LE CCT & RGBW, 8 bit resolution per function”| DMX Channel | Value Range | Percent | Function |
|---|---|---|---|
| 1 | 0–255 | 0–100 | Dimmer closed → open |
| 2 | 0–255 | 0–100 | Color temperature CCT 2,800 K → 10,000 K |
| 3 | 0–10 11–20 21–119 120–145 146–244 245–255 | 0–4 5–8 9–47 48–57 58–96 97–100 | Green–Magenta Point neutral / no effect full minus green −99% → −1% neutral / no effect 1% → 99% full plus green |
| 4 | 0–255 | 0–100 | Crossfade to Color White → RGBW color |
| 5 | 0–255 | 0–100 | Red Intensity 0% → 100% |
| 6 | 0–255 | 0–100 | Green Intensity 0% → 100% |
| 7 | 0–255 | 0–100 | Blue Intensity 0% → 100% |
| 8 | 0–255 | 0–100 | White Intensity 0% → 100% |
2. Disguise Configuration
Section titled “2. Disguise Configuration”This example uses the Skypanel 60C, but the steps apply to all models.
Only the fixture size and resolution differ:
| Model | Physical Size (approx.) | Resolution (engines) |
|---|---|---|
| 30C | ~0.35 × 0.3 m | 1 × 1 |
| 60C | ~0.645 × 0.3 m | 2 × 1 |
| 120C | ~1.29 × 0.3 m | 4 × 1 |
| 360C | varies | 4 × 3 |
Create a new DMX Light
Section titled “Create a new DMX Light”- Go to Stage → DMX Light.
- Click + to add a new DMX light.
- Set the size of the Skypanel 60C to 0.645 m × 0.3 m.
- Set the resolution according to your Skypanel model.

4. Fixture Configuration
Section titled “4. Fixture Configuration”-
Go to Fixture and create a new fixture type.

-
Set the number of channels to 8 (one RGBW engine).

-
Set the fixture layout (number of engines):
- 30C → 1 × 1
- 60C → 2 × 1
- 120C → 4 × 1
- 360C → 4 × 3
5. Driver Setup (DMX Personality)
Section titled “5. Driver Setup (DMX Personality)”Create a new driver that maps each DMX channel:
- Channel 1 → Dimmer
- Channel 5 → Red
- Channel 6 → Green
- Channel 7 → Blue
- Channel 8 → White
All other parameters (including pan/tilt) should be set to 0.

Required Commands for RGBW Mixing
Section titled “Required Commands for RGBW Mixing”Create two commands in the driver:
- Set Dimmer (Ch. 1) → 255
- Set Crossfade to Color (Ch. 4) → 255

6. Addressing
Section titled “6. Addressing”The addressing configuration allows Disguise to activate the DMX data and patch the fixture to a universe and channel.
- Enable Active to output DMX data.
If this is disabled, the fixture will receive no DMX. - Create a new Assigner and set:
- Universe
- Starting channel
- Number of units (engines):
- 30C → 1
- 60C → 2
- 120C → 4
- 360C → 12

Troubleshooting
Section titled “Troubleshooting”| Symptom | Likely Cause | Fix |
|---|---|---|
| Fixture stays white | Channel 4 not set to 255 | Check driver commands |
| No output | “Active” not enabled | Enable in Addressing |
| Colour incorrect | Wrong Skypanel mode | Set Mode 24 |
| Only part of fixture responds | Incorrect unit count | Verify resolution mapping |
